Transaction 51ea655518449f9252845fdb7544f527d79ddcf19f87b4e7cb46a30717df4af2
2 Input
2 Outputs
- 51ea655518449f9252845fdb7544f527d79ddcf19f87b4e7cb46a30717df4af2:0
- 51ea655518449f9252845fdb7544f527d79ddcf19f87b4e7cb46a30717df4af2:1
value 28319
address 1JC8VTzpyQ7L9bg7N8BWtkmgNeMK4tErwm
value 258000
address 3FFJvQ99YTeC9xVxo8fZDWK88gmiisuDLX